    PROSCIUTTO WRAPPED PORK CHOP


    Source of Recipe


    the Scotto family, owners of the Fresco Restaurant

    List of Ingredients




    6 bone in, center cut pork chops
    ¼ pound of thinly sliced Parma Prosciutto
    1 tablespoon fresh rosemary leaves, rough chop
    1 tablespoon fresh sage leaves, rough chop
    ¼ tablespoon freshly crushed black pepper
    ¼ cup extra virgin olive oil

    Recipe



    Preheat oven to 375 to 400°. Center cut pork chops should be at least 1½-inches thick and fat trimmed away from bone. Season each side of pork chop evenly with rosemary, sage and cracked black pepper. (Note: Do not season with salt due to Prosciutto’s salty nature). Take 2 pieces of thinly sliced Prosciutto and wrap one continuous band around each pork chop until Prosciutto meets. After all pork chops have been wrapped, heat 10-inch, preferably non-stick sauté pan, to medium-high heat and brown pork chops evenly on both sides (approximately 2 minutes). Place all pork chops on sheet pan and cook in preheated oven for approximately 15 to 20 minutes for medium; 30 minutes for well down.


    Serves 6.
